A. The direct air distance between Chicago and Sao Paulo is approximately 5,241 miles. This represents the shortest path between the two cities, commonly known as the "as-the-crow-flies" distance, measured from airport to airport. This distance is often used when calculating flight durations or planning air travel routes.
